
Multiplayer gaming is increasingly popular. Players can now easily connect with others worldwide to compete or team up, all from the comfort of their homes. A growing trend is ‘crossplay,’ which lets people play together regardless of their platform – for example, players on PlayStation 5, Xbox, and PC can all play the same game together. This expands the game’s community and creates more opportunities for everyone.
Letting players on PlayStation 5 and Xbox play with each other, and with those on PC, simply makes games more popular and creates a larger community.

The Finals Is the Perfect Online Shooter to Play With Friends
With so many online shooters available, Finals has quickly become popular. This free-to-play game from Embark Studios features teams competing in matches that feel like a game show. Players work together to achieve goals in different game types.
The Finals has quickly become popular due to its thrilling matches and incredibly well-designed levels. Each level feels large and dynamic, allowing players to climb, descend, and significantly alter the environment. The game also offers a variety of character builds that promote creative strategies and thoughtful gameplay.
Fatal Fury: City of the Wolves Was Over 25 Years in the Making
SNK and fighting game fans had been eagerly awaiting Fatal Fury: City of the Wolves, and it finally arrived in April 2025. The game generated a lot of buzz by featuring real-world personalities – football star Cristiano Ronaldo and DJ Salvatore Ganacci – as playable characters.
City of the Wolves builds upon the gameplay of previous titles, including a system that lets players customize damage boosts based on their health. It also introduces a new ‘Rev System’ that works similarly to the ‘Drive System’ found in Street Fighter 6. The game features smooth online play with rollback netcode and allows players on different platforms to play together.

Gears of War: Reloaded Lets PS5 In on the Action
Xbox is now bringing its popular games to PlayStation, with a remastered version of Gears of War: Reloaded recently launching on PS5. This allows even more players to enjoy the intense action as Marcus Fenix battles the Locust, and players on Xbox and PlayStation can play together online.
Gears of War: Reloaded is an updated version of the game originally remastered for Xbox One. It improves the game’s graphics and makes it run better on different systems. The competitive multiplayer is still fun, and the gritty, cover-based shooting remains satisfying when playing against others.

Path of Exile 2 Has a Crossplay Feature Even in Early Access
Launched in December 2024, Path of Exile 2 is already impressing players who got early access. While the first Path of Exile came out in 2013, this sequel has revitalized the series. Set years after the original game, players will embark on an epic adventure, fighting against evil and a dangerous new threat called the Corruption.
Path of Exile 2 lets you choose from six character classes, each with customizable skills, so you can play exactly how you like. A great feature is the ability to play with up to six friends. Even though it’s still in early access, the game is looking very promising, and it already supports crossplay, letting you play with others on different platforms.
